Introducing the Omoeraku Handcrafted Japanese Beech Wood Spatula - Large Square by Miranda Style Co. This unique spatula is skillfully crafted by woodworking craftsmen in Kanuma City, Tochigi Prefecture. It features a convenient hook in the middle, allowing you to rest it on the table or edge of the pan. To ensure its longevity, simply avoid soaking the spatula and wipe it clean with a dry or damp cloth. Inspired by the "Shrines and Temples of Nikko", this spatula showcases the beauty and craftsmanship of traditional Japanese woodworking.
